Goyokin is a drama, action film released in 1969 exploring themes of village massacre. Directed by Hideo Gosha, it stars Tatsuya Nakadai, Tetsuro Tamba, Yōko Tsukasa. A guilt-haunted samurai warrior attempts to stop a massacre taking place.
